About

We do data recovery & phone repair for most phones and Apple products. We repair iPhone XS, X, iPhone 8 plus, LG phones, Samsung Galaxy phones. Tablet repair (most models), iPhone Repair, iPad repair, iTouch repair, Mac repair, we provide iPhone 8 plus, 8, 7 plus, 7, 6 plus, 6, 5s, 5c,5, 4s, 4 repairs. Here are some of the services offered: cracked glass repair, LCD repair, battery replacement, speaker dock connector, camera replacement, home button repair, speaker repair, camera back and front repair, back cover, signal cable replacement, iPhone color conversion (white, pink, red, black, green and yellow). Any generation of iPhones, iPads, iPod Touch or tablets. Walk in and get instant diagnosed on most devices, same day service also available (by appointment). 99% parts in stock. All repairs have warranty (except water damage). Please call to make an appointment!
